Facility - Bear Down Beach

Bear Down Beach is home to the women's Beach Volleyball team and is one of the newest additions to the athletics facilities. The courts were completed in December 2013 in preparation for the inaugural sand volleyball season in the spring of 2014. Sand volleyball became the school’s 20th varsity sport when it was announced on Jan. 15, 2013. The facility features four championship courts which contain 18” deep, beach quality, high-end sand. Arizona Athletics has future plans to add grandstands, concessions, restrooms as well as a new front entry. 

Located at the corner of Enke Drive and Campbell Avenue at Jimenez Field, the Arizona Sand Volleyball Courts are centrally located to campus as they are adjacent to McKale Center and directly south of the Hillenbrand Aquatic Center. Admission to sand volleyball is free and fans are encouraged to bring lawn chairs and/or blankets. 

TICKETS

Bear Down Beach is a non-ticketed event location.

Admission is free

Fans are allowed to bring their own chairs and umbrellas with them to home beach volleyball events.

Quick FactS 

  • Facility was completed in December 2013 ahead of inaugural season in 2014
  • Four courts with 18" deep beach-quality sand
  • Served as host for the 2017 Pac-12 Tournament
  • Wildcats have posted a winning record at home every year since 2014
  • Beach Volleyball became the 20th varsity sport at Arizona
